随着区块链技术的发展,发行自己的代币已经成为了许多项目和个人的梦想。TP钱包作为一款流行的数字资产钱包,不仅可以帮助用户管理和存储各种加密货币,还提供了强大的功能来支持代币的发行。本文将详细介绍如何使用TP钱包发行自己的代币,并解答一些常见问题。
代币(Token)是指在区块链网络上发行的一种数字资产,通常用于表示某种权益或功能。代币可以在多种场合下使用,比如作为交换媒介、参与项目治理、获取服务或奖励等。
那么,为什么很多人和项目方选择发行自己的代币呢?主要有以下几个原因:
1. **融资与投资**:代币发行(ICO)可以为项目提供首轮融资,吸引投资者的参与。通过代币的发行,项目方可以融资并且在未来实现价值的回报。
2. **社区建设**:发行代币可以创造一个用户和粉丝社区,增加用户的参与感与归属感,促进项目的发展。
3. **激励机制**:代币可以用作用户奖励、激励措施或者参与网络治理的凭证,从而提升用户的活跃度和忠诚度。
TP钱包是一个多链数字钱包,支持以太坊(Ethereum)、比特币(Bitcoin)、TRON等多种区块链资产。它为用户提供了安全、便捷的数字资产管理服务。除了基本的货币转账功能,TP钱包还支持DApp的使用和智能合约的交互,使得用户可以轻松使用去中心化金融(DeFi)等多种应用。
TP钱包的优势包括:强大的安全性、简单易用的用户界面以及全面的功能支持,使得无论是新手还是专业用户都能轻松掌握。
以下是通过TP钱包发行自己的代币的详细步骤:
发行代币需要使用智能合约,这是代币的核心。首先需要熟悉Solidity等编程语言,编写代币智能合约的代码。你可以选择基于ERC20或ERC721标准来创建。
以下是一个ERC20代币的示例代码:
// SPDX-License-Identifier: MIT
pragma solidity ^0.8.0;
import "@openzeppelin/contracts/token/ERC20/ERC20.sol";
contract MyToken is ERC20 {
constructor(uint256 initialSupply) ERC20("MyToken", "MTK") {
_mint(msg.sender, initialSupply);
}
}
完成智能合约的编写后,需要部署到以太坊或其他支持智能合约的区块链上。你需要使用一些开发工具,比如Remix、Truffle等,通过TP钱包连接钱包地址进行部署。部署时需要支付一定的Gas费用。
发布成功后,你将获得一个智能合约地址。确保保存好这个地址,因为你将需要它来发送和接收代币。
在TP钱包中添加你的代币可以通过访问“资产”选项,选择“添加代币”,输入你的代币合约地址。如果代币合约正确,TP钱包将自动识别代币并显示相关信息。
在发行代币后,建议进行一些测试,例如发送少量代币到其他地址,确保智能合约的功能正常。同时,通过社交媒体、社区以及其他渠道宣传你的代币,吸引更多的用户参与。
在TP钱包中发行代币虽然简单,但依然有几个前提条件需要满足:
1. **了解智能合约**: 发行代币需要编写和部署智能合约,这要求用户了解智能合约的基本概念与技术细节,如Solidity编程语言。
2. **具备足够的资金**: 部署智能合约需要支付Gas费用,这要求用户在其TP钱包中有足够的以太坊或其他相关链的代币。
3. **规划代币的属性**: 在编写智能合约之前,用户需要规划代币的基本属性,例如代币名称、符号、总量、发行方式(例如一次性发行或分期发行)等。
智能合约是一段代码,定义了代币的行为和功能。因此,了解智能合约是必须的。许多开发者选择使用开源代码库,如OpenZeppelin,来简化编写过程。使用标准化的代币合约可以避免一些常见的安全性问题。
Gas费用是部署代币合约时的交易费用,不同的区块链网络费用有所不同。在部署之前,建议用户能够估算出大概的费用,并确保钱包中有足够的余额以完成所有的交易。
在设计代币时,用户应当考虑代币的用途、模式和经济模型。例如,代币是为了支持某个项目的生态系统,还是用于投资和交易,这将直接影响代币的设计。
代币的流动性是指代币在市场上易于买卖的程度,而流动性不足可能会导致代币价格的不稳定或无法交易。要确保代币在市场上的流动性,可以遵循以下几点建议:
1. **选择合适的交易所**: 考虑将代币上线到较大的去中心化交易所(DEX)或中心化交易所(CEX),比如Uniswap、Binance等,这可以有效提高代币的曝光率和流动性。
2. **建立流动性池**: 在去中心化交易所上创建流动性池,可以通过存入一定数量的代币与ETH或其他资产,来提高交易的流动性。
3. **参与社区活动**: 通过举办空投、奖励、交易榜等活动,鼓励用户进行代币交易,提升代币的活跃度。
4. **保持透明度和沟通**: 定期向社区通报项目进展与未来计划,提高用户的信任感,从而促进代币交易。
选择上线的交易所至关重要。大型交易所能带来更多的流量,但通常会有更高的上市门槛。去中心化交易所虽然门槛低,但流量相对较少,因此选择时需要综合考虑项目的目标、资源以及市场需求等因素。
在去中心化交易所上创建流动性池可以鼓励更多的交易。流动性池允许用户在没有交易对手的情况下介入交易。这种方式促进了更多的交易,同时可以获得交易费用的分润。
发行代币可能涉及多方面的法律风险,特别是在不同司法管辖区的法律法规下。以下是一些主要的法律风险:
1. **合规性问题**: 在许多国家,代币被视为证券,其发行受到严格的法律监管。因此,在发行代币之前,确保符合当地法律法规至关重要,避免未来潜在的法律纠纷。
2. **投资者保护**: 很多国家有投资者保护法案,可以规定代币发行方的义务,比如信息披露、反欺诈等。因此,合规发行代币不仅能保护投资者权益,有助于项目的可持续发展。
3. **反洗钱(AML)和了解客户(KYC)**: 随着监管越来越严格,许多交易所都要求依据AML和KYC政策进行身份验证,这可能会使得部分用户无法参与,同时增加项目方的合规成本。
合规性是代币发行的核心问题之一。不同国家对加密货币的法律和法规存在差异,因此发行方应当在启动项目之前进行充分的法律咨询,明确法律地位,确保符合法律要求。
通过透明的信息披露和合规行为,可鼓励更多的投资者参与,有助于项目的正面发展并建立良好的声誉。规范操作能降低法律风险,并增强社区的信任感。
推广代币项目是获取投资者和用户参与的重要一步。以下是一些有效的推广策略:
1. **社交媒体营销**: 利用Twitter、Telegram、Discord等社交媒体,与你的目标用户互动,发布项目的最新消息,增强用户的参与感。
2. **内容营销**: 发布有关项目的白皮书、博客文章、视频和指南,帮助用户深入了解代币的特性和优势。良好的内容可以提升项目的专业形象。
3. **合作与联盟**: 与其他项目合作、参与区块链展会和会议,扩大曝光率,寻求潜在的合作伙伴。
4. **社区建设**: 创建项目的社区,定期举行AMA(Ask Me Anything)活动,了解用户反馈,提升用户的忠诚度和满意度。
社交媒体是与用户直接沟通的重要渠道。在推广代币时,创建强有力的社交媒体战略,可以有效提高项目的可见性。密切关注用户的反馈,及时回应,增强用户的信任感和参与感。
内容是吸引和留住用户的重要手段。发布高质量的内容可以塑造项目的专业形象,提升用户的教育程度,帮助用户理解代币的价值和使用场景,从而增强参与意愿。
总之,发行自己的代币不仅需要技术上的准备,还需要全面的市场策略与法律合规考量。通过TP钱包这一工具,用户可以更方便地实施其想法,推动项目的成长和发展。